How Reliable is the Citroen 2CV?

Based on 92,003 MOT tests across 7,843 vehicles.

70.7%
Pass Rate
806
Miles/Year
45
Year Lifespan
7,843
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ded 6,227
Su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ded 3,796
fog lamp not working 3,473
Axle king pin has excessive play in pin and/or bush adversely affecting the steering 3,198
position lamp(s) not working 2,853

D32 NND is a 1987 Citroen 2CV in Blue with a 602c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 1987 Citroen 2CV models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.5% with a typical mileage of 59,863 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Citroen 2CV f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 6,227 recorded failures. If you're considering buying D32 NND,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en 2CV typically stays on UK roads for around 45 years. At 39 years old, this Citroen 2CV is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
